Common challenges include navigating narrow corridors, lift access restrictions in HDBs and condominiums, and coordinating delivery timings with building management.
Inspect the furniture for any scratches, dents, or manufacturing defects before the delivery team leaves. Ensure all parts are included and match your order.
Measure your doorways and lift dimensions beforehand and compare them to the furnitures dimensions. If it doesnt fit, discuss disassembly options or alternative delivery methods with the retailer *before* the delivery date.
Setup usually involves assembling the furniture pieces, positioning them on your balcony, and removing packaging materials. Confirm with the retailer if setup is included in the delivery fee.
Immediately notify the retailer and document the damage with photos. Most retailers have a return or exchange policy for damaged goods, so follow their procedures for resolution.
Clarify all potential costs beforehand, including delivery charges, assembly fees, disposal fees for old furniture (if applicable), and any surcharges for difficult access (e.g., stairs).
